Diblock Copolymer Core-Shell Nanoparticles as Template for Mesoporous Carbons : Independent Tuning of Pore Size and Pore Wall Thickness
Latex templating using core-shell particles represents a unique opportunity to design mesoporous carbons with a high level of control on textural properties.
